Descargué eclipse y descomprimí el archivo en una carpeta y también agregué algunos complementos, cambié algunas configuraciones.
Si copié esta carpeta en un pendrive y la abrí en otra PC, ¿funcionarán todos mis complementos y complementos?
Descargué eclipse y descomprimí el archivo en una carpeta y también agregué algunos complementos, cambié algunas configuraciones.
Si copié esta carpeta en un pendrive y la abrí en otra PC, ¿funcionarán todos mis complementos y complementos?
Respuestas:
Sí. Eclipse es portátil. Sin embargo, debe especificar la carpeta del espacio de trabajo y la máquina virtual Java en la línea de comandos. Esto evita que eclipse use la VM rota que viene con Windows y le permite acceder al espacio de trabajo incluso si la letra de la unidad ha cambiado.
eclipse.exe -clean -vm %JAVA_HOME%/bin/javaw.exe -data %WORKSPACE%
FYI: Java VM también es portátil, por lo que puede colocar Java y Eclipse en la misma unidad de disco USB.
NOTA: La configuración del proyecto Eclipse puede no ser portátil. Esto depende de cómo configure su archivo .classpath. Intente utilizar rutas relativas siempre que sea posible.
clean
comando?
Eclipse almacena todos sus complementos y configuraciones en su propia estructura de directorio, por lo que es portátil, sorprendentemente fácil e intuitivo. He usado Eclipse de forma portátil sin ningún problema. Todo lo que puedo recomendar es un par de pasos adicionales para hacer tu vida un poco más fácil y esto es lo que hago:
Simplemente descargo el archivo zip de Eclipse, lo extraigo a un directorio en el escritorio y sigo los siguientes pasos.
Copie el tiempo de ejecución Java de una computadora que lo tiene instalado en su directorio Eclipse. La carpeta con Java debe llamarse "jre" para que termines con lo siguiente:
Eclipse
|
|___jre
|___bin
| |___files
|
|___lib
|___files
Esto significa que puede funcionar en cualquier máquina que no tenga Java instalado sin tener que ejecutar configuraciones especiales de línea de comando o ruta. Simplemente ejecute eclipse.exe
y encontrará el tiempo de ejecución de Java jre
para usted y continuará felizmente. Neato
Después de eso, cuando Eclipse solicita un espacio de trabajo, simplemente entro .\Workspace
para que el directorio del espacio de trabajo se cree dentro del directorio de eclipse, y parece que todos los detalles del espacio de trabajo se mantienen en ese directorio de manera "relativa", por lo que no importa si la letra de la unidad cambia. Los complementos como Pydev mantienen su configuración en la carpeta del espacio de trabajo (en una carpeta llamada ".metadata") para que, una vez que lo haya configurado, también sean recordados entre los lugares.
Y Voila, Eclipse portátil.
Puede copiar este directorio Eclipse entre lugares y todo parece "simplemente funcionar".
Para la escuela, elegí asignar mi espacio de trabajo de Eclipse a un directorio compartido de Dropbox . Cada vez que comencé Eclipse, usé ese directorio como espacio de trabajo. Me ayudó a trabajar en múltiples instalaciones de Eclipse al mismo tiempo con bastante facilidad.
¿Probaste Eclipse Portable ? Algunos de mis amigos lo usan y dicen que funciona bien.
Data/workspace
mientras se sigue utilizando una ruta relativa?
Antigua pregunta, pero desde la aparición de Oomph, el instalador de Eclipse, Eclipse ya no es portátil: contamina su directorio de usuarios domésticos y se arrastra en al menos 6 archivos de configuración diferentes, ubicados en 5 directorios diferentes. Se ha convertido en una pesadilla.
Debería. Tengo la instalación de eclipse en una unidad flash y funciona bien. Sin embargo, a veces tengo que seleccionar qué JDK estoy usando.
Como muchos otros dijeron, Eclipse es portátil y / o puede hacerse portátil bastante fácil. Tenga en cuenta que, dependiendo del tipo de proyecto, puede ocurrir una gran cantidad de actividad de escritura en el contenido del espacio de trabajo (no en la instalación), por ejemplo, cuando se crean automáticamente los archivos de clase después de guardar un archivo Java o para mantener el historial del espacio de trabajo local. Esto podría no solo ralentizar Eclipse significativamente, sino que también podría reducir la esperanza de vida de su unidad flash.
.zip
Eclipse?